Interpreting medical evidence—from clinical trials to patient records—transforms raw data into actionable insights. It involves critically evaluating study validity, statistical significance, and applicability to individual cases. Clinicians use it to guide treatment decisions, while legal teams and insurers rely on it for case evaluations. Ultimately, patients benefit most, as this rigorous analysis ensures safer, more effective, and personalized healthcare outcomes.
